6 May 2026, Goa
A delegation comprising press reporters and media representative, along with the officials from Dr. Balasaheb Sawant Konkan Krishi Vidyapeeth, Dapoli, visited the ICAR–Central Coastal Agricultural Research Institute, Goa today. The delegation included a total of 20 media personnel from Ratnagiri district of Maharashtra, who were provided an overview of the institute’s mandate, research programmes, and significant contributions towards the development of coastal agriculture and the welfare of coastal farmers.

Dr Parveen Kumar, Director, welcomed the delegation and briefed them on the institute’s achievements, innovative research initiatives, and extension efforts. A detailed presentation on ‘Best Practices and Innovative Research Initiatives of ICAR–CCARI,’ was delivered followed by an interactive session that witnessed active participation from the visiting media professionals.

An extensive field visit to various experimental farms, research units, and demonstration sites was subsequently conducted, during which ongoing research activities and technologies were explained in detail.
The visit enabled the media delegation to gain first-hand exposure to applied agricultural research and farmer-centric innovations of ICAR–CCARI, facilitating informed dissemination of the institute’s work to the wider public.
